Halite- composition; sodium chloride
Color- colorless , white, red,
yellow,
orange, pink, blue, green, violet,
and gray
Streak- white
Hardness- 2- 2 ½
Luster- Vitreous
Cleavage- 1, all sides - cubic
Fracture- conchoidal
Transparent to Translucent
Other examples: salt, common salt,
natural salt, rock salt, and hydro halite.
Uses- halite is the source of common
salt. Some of its most famous uses are as food seasoning for road safety
to melt snow and ice and for medicinal purposes.
Noteworthy localities- Halite comes
from numerous localities. Perfect cubes embedded on matrixes have come
from Salzburg, Austria. Also enormous underground deposits exist in certain
parts of New York.
